Output 86213d8c2fb415c936132dcc4e7b786435162ab71783c5cc5a0452dd69e78d56:358

value
510578
script pubkey
OP_0 OP_PUSHBYTES_20 50aad2c224fa400bae92b6c4d42d3faf37ea78df
address
bc1q2z4d9s3ylfqqht5jkmzdgtfl4um757xl06xums
transaction
86213d8c2fb415c936132dcc4e7b786435162ab71783c5cc5a0452dd69e78d56